It is very risky indeed. My advise would be don't do it, since it is most likely a close to release build. If it were an early beta, and not from an "Integral" (Subsistence, Substance, etc) product, I'd say go for it immediately. Keep in mind that betas/release builds of these won't be as interesting since the main game had already been released and was mostly unchanged for these versions.
I do own a beta/review copy of Snatcher (shown here), and although it holds great value to me as a collector, i was really afraid it was simply a burnt golden disc. In that case, it proved to be a different build and we still haven't found a single difference, only on the binary level and save games that don't load later into the game. Nothing new to watch there.
A couple of hundred.. maybe as a collector. A thousand? I think it is way too high for such an item that any magazine would have around, or for an item with the characteristics I described above.

I wouldn't, as tempting as it is, it looks like a scam.
The 2-disc version of substance is most likely the same as the retail version (PAL territories had 2 discs).
Metal Gear Solid 3 Subsistence, would most likely be the same as the retail version. No major improvements but the 3D camera. The MGO access would probably be linked to a temp site Konami hosted to test it, you will NOT be able to access that (remember Jack or Dave's MGO hack).
VR missions does look tempting but again its probably the retail version. VR missions beta most likely look the same as the retail.
The beta versions I'd be most tempted to buy would be the MGS2 SOL beta and MGS3 Snake Eater beta if it was in a very early stage of development, remember how different Snake looked in the early builds? and how Snake was in the Plant missions. The earliest build of MGS3 Snake Eater beta was literally Pliskin in MGS3, later build was that the MGS3 camouflage demo video they showed us.
The fact that he doesn't want to show any pictures means its a scam. Heck if i had to fork out $1000 for a "beta", I'd ask for some evidence that it is what I'm looking for.
The pics that come to mind when I read this are those promo MGS disc's that was on sale on ebay which I though were fake.

In January I watched a 30 minute TV program on a channel called Bravo called gamer.tv where it was a MGS 20th anniversary special, They were giving us the history of the Metal Gear games and showed what was going on in the 20th anniversary party. When they were talking about MGS1 they told us that MGS1 actually started development early but because part of the Konami offices were destroyed in the earthquake they had to relocate and start again. I never knew about that either until I watched it on TV.
They even showed pics of the office in a wreck.
This is all I could find on the Internet:
Source:http://sec.edgar-online.com/2003/08/06/ ... ction1.aspJanuary 1995 A part of the present Kobe Building was destroyed by the
Hanshin/Awaji Earthquake.
